Found a way to make blackbox block in its select() call. Theres a comment above it say this is possible but near impossible.. seems not to be the case :| It does it perfecetly consistantly on my machine if I follow the right steps.
This is, of course, with the latest cvs version. But should work for the last few (all?) alphas too. Also, I am using the cvs version of bbkeys. With bbkeys 0.8.4, this doesn't happen for me. However, it seems that blackbox blocking is still a problem regardless. I will attempt to track down what change in bbkeys caused it. heres the .xinitrc: bbkeys -i& gkrellm -w & exec blackbox Then, once blackbox has loaded: launch a terminal. In the terminal run: % bbkeys The X server should be entirely frozen at this point. gdb reports this backtrace. 0x402547ce in select () from /lib/libc.so.6 (gdb) bt #0 0x402547ce in select () from /lib/libc.so.6 #1 0xbffff4a4 in ?? () #2 0x0809f5af in main (argc=1, argv=0xbffff864) at main.cc:160 That's with debug symbols enabled.. :\ not sure why it gets a ??. Can anyone else reproduce this? xOr -- I am damn unsatisfied to be killed in this way.
